Output 307059edbf554d343b8b269afdb507ae93a34b68a4c0a6896a9e09c421d787be:62

value
107396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320d4fcebb8e957bc5ee86b3ec79f5e088f5f047 OP_EQUAL
address
36Fff3xN99Yo1Hcn4apNiguA1MVp6z2rHv
transaction
307059edbf554d343b8b269afdb507ae93a34b68a4c0a6896a9e09c421d787be
spent
true